Melamine board is also called decorative board, paint-free board, ecological board, and one-time forming board. Its base material can be particleboard, medium-density fiberboard and solid wood multilayer board, which is made by bonding the base material and the surface impregnated paper. Melamine board has extremely high requirements on the flatness of the base material board during production. Because the expansion coefficient of both sides of the board is the same, it is not easy to deform, bright in color, diversified in variety, and the surface is more wear-resistant and corrosion-resistant. It is very good at waterproofing and sealing. It is economical and affordable. It is a very mature alternative to natural products. Compared with traditional paint decoration, it has a high environmental protection coefficient. According to customer needs, different inner base materials can be used, and according to different cores and different glues, a variety of products of different quality grades can be derived. They are waterproof and moisture-proof, with dense structure, uniform and delicate texture, and environmentally friendly and odorless for long-term use. Boards are indispensable materials in furniture manufacturing and can be used to make wardrobes, desks, bed frames, sofa frames, etc. Different types of boards, such as solid wood boards, particle boards, density boards, etc., are suitable for different types of furniture due to their different characteristics. Solid wood boards are often used for floor paving in living rooms, bedrooms and other spaces due to their natural texture and feel, creating a warm and natural home atmosphere. Boards can be used to make interior decoration elements such as background walls, ceilings, partitions, etc., to enhance the beauty and functionality of the space. For example, gypsum boards are often used in the construction of ceilings and partitions, while fireproof boards can be used for wall decoration in kitchens, bathrooms and other spaces due to their fireproof and heat-resistant properties.
